everlasting
[ ev-er-las-ting, -lah-sting ]
adjective
- lasting forever; eternal:
everlasting future life.
Antonyms:
- lasting or continuing for an indefinitely long time:
the everlasting hills.
- incessant; constantly recurring:
He is plagued by everlasting attacks of influenza.
- wearisome; tedious:
She tired of his everlasting puns.
noun
- eternal duration; eternity:
What is the span of one life compared with the everlasting?
- the Everlasting, God.
- any of various plants that retain their shape or color when dried, as certain composite plants of the genera Helichrysum, Gnaphalium, and Helipterum.
